Using the Python sort() function for ascending order

Python’s sort() function allows you to sort iterable objects (such as a list or tuple) in ascending order.

Syntax:

list.sort()

Usage:

To sort the list in ascending order, just call the sort() function, No need to pass any parameters.

my_list = [5, 3, 1, 2, 4]
my_list.sort()

print(my_list)  # 输出:[1, 2, 3, 4, 5]

Note:

  • sort() function modifies the original list.
  • The sorting method is based on the comparison of elements. For custom objects, you need to implement the __lt__() method to define comparison logic.
  • sort() can handle numbers, strings, and other comparable objects.

Reverse order:

To sort the list in reverse order (descending order), you can use reverse=True Parameters:

my_list.sort(reverse=True)

Custom sorting:

For situations where custom sorting rules are required, you can use the key parameter to specify a comparison function that accepts a single element and returns the key used for comparison.

def my_sort_func(x):
    return x[1]

my_list = [('Item 1', 10), ('Item 2', 5), ('Item 3', 15)]
my_list.sort(key=my_sort_func)

print(my_list)  # 输出:[('Item 2', 5), ('Item 1', 10), ('Item 3', 15)]
